Editorial: Special pulping and engineering issues of TAPPI Journal yield important recovery cycle research, TAPPI Journal June 2024

ABSTRACT: The June issue of TAPPI Journal, which is dominated by recovery cycle topics, is the last PEERS issue organized by Dr. Peter Hart, the fomer editor-in-chief who passed away this past May. Peter, who was heavily involved with TAPPI’s Pulp Manufacture Division and various pulping-related committees, also started working with conference technical program planning starting in 2005 with the Engineering, Pulping and Environmental (EPE) Conference, which was the precursor to the more recent Pulping, Engineering, Environmental, Recycling and Sustainability (PEERS) Conference. He was also involved with other conference planning, including that for the International Pulp Bleaching Conference. In addition, Peter was a yearly attendee of such conferences starting as far back as 1990.

Editorial: The state of cellulosic nanotechnology: June conference captures current and emerging trends, TAPPI Journal July 2023

ABSTRACT: From June 12-16, 253 participants from 18 countries gathered in Vancouver, BC, Canada, for TAPPI’s 2023 International Conference on Nanotechnology for Renewable Materials. Representatives from academia, industry, and federal research institutes could choose from among 140 technical presentations on production, characterization, applications, and functionalization of renewable nanomaterials.
